We are seeking an experienced Scrum Master to support a software development team operating under Scrum Agile with a two-week sprint cadence. The Scrum Master will facilitate all Agile ceremonies, manage the team's Jira board and workflow, and help ensure the team remains focused, aligned, and continuously improving. This role also includes light technical responsibilities to support the team's systems engineering needs.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Facilitate all Scrum ceremonies including sprint planning, daily stand-ups, backlog refinement, sprint reviews, and retrospectives.
  • Manage and maintain the team's Jira board, ensuring tasks are properly tracked, organized, and updated throughout each sprint.
  • Partner with the Product Owner to maintain a clear and actionable product backlog.
  • Support the team by identifying and removing impediments.
  • Coach team members in Agile principles and foster an environment of continuous improvement.
  • Track and communicate sprint progress and key metrics to stakeholders.
  • Perform light systems engineering tasks such as coordinating server certifications and executing basic AWS-related activities.
  • Conduct product demos for stakeholders and assist in manual testing of features to ensure functionality and user readiness.

Required Qualifications:
  • Active TS/SCI clearance with full-scope polygraph.
  • Professional experience serving as a Scrum Master for a technical development team.
  • Strong understanding of Scrum Agile practices, frameworks, and ceremonies.
  • Hands-on experience with Jira for task, workflow, and sprint management.
  • Ability to perform basic technical tasks including server certification coordination and light AWS work.
  • Strong communication, facilitation, and problem-solving skills.

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Scrum Master certification (CSM, PSM, or equivalent).
  • Experience supporting systems engineering or DevOps-related activities.
  • Familiarity with manual testing practices and demonstration delivery.
  • Experience in mission-focused or secure environments.
